Definition

Multi-Currency Simulation is a financial modeling technique used to analyze how fluctuations in exchange rates affect financial performance, cash flow, and operational outcomes across organizations that operate in multiple currencies. The model simulates currency movements and evaluates their impact on revenue, expenses, assets, and liabilities reported in different currencies.

Finance teams rely on these simulations to anticipate foreign exchange volatility and understand how currency changes influence financial reporting and strategic planning. How Multi-Currency Simulation Works

The simulation begins by identifying financial activities exposed to foreign exchange risk, such as international sales, cross-border supplier payments, foreign subsidiaries, or global capital investments. Each transaction or financial account is associated with a specific functional currency and translated into a reporting currency.

The model then simulates different exchange-rate scenarios over time, projecting how financial statements may change under varying currency conditions. Example Scenario: Global Revenue Forecast

Consider a multinational company headquartered in the United States that generates revenue in Europe and Asia. The company records the following annual revenue:

  • €40,000,000 from European operations

  • ¥5,000,000,000 from Japanese operations

Assume the current exchange rates are:

  • 1 EUR = 1.10 USD

  • 1 JPY = 0.007 USD

Under these rates, total revenue converts to:

  • European revenue: €40,000,000 × 1.10 = $44,000,000

  • Japanese revenue: ¥5,000,000,000 × 0.007 = $35,000,000

Total reported revenue = $79,000,000

Using a simulation model integrated with multi-currency budget control and multi-currency consolidation, finance teams test scenarios where exchange rates shift by ±10%. These simulations reveal how currency fluctuations may increase or decrease reported revenue, enabling better forecasting and financial planning.

Interpretation of Currency Simulation Results

Results from Multi-Currency Simulation provide insights into how currency movements influence profitability and financial stability. When exchange rates move favorably, foreign revenue may increase after conversion into the reporting currency. Conversely, unfavorable movements may reduce reported revenue or increase the cost of foreign-denominated expenses.

Finance leaders use these insights to evaluate exposure across financial operations and to determine whether adjustments to pricing, hedging strategies, or capital allocation are necessary. Currency simulations are particularly valuable for companies with global supply chains, international subsidiaries, or cross-border financing arrangements.

Best Practices for Effective Multi-Currency Simulation

To ensure reliable simulation results, organizations must maintain accurate exchange-rate data, consistent financial reporting standards, and well-structured financial models.

  • Use historical exchange-rate volatility to calibrate simulations

  • Model multiple economic scenarios rather than a single forecast

  • Align simulations with global financial reporting requirements

  • Regularly update currency exposure assumptions

  • Integrate simulation outputs into strategic financial planning

These practices help finance teams anticipate currency-related risks while improving the accuracy of international financial forecasts.
